Hamilton is a city at the western end of Lake Ontario in Ontario, long known as Canada's 'Steel City' for its important iron and steel industry.
Hamilton has more waterfalls than any other city in the world — over 100 waterfalls and cascades are hidden in its ravines and escarpment trails!

The Royal Botanical Gardens is one of the largest botanical gardens in Canada, with gorgeous flower collections, nature trails, and a sanctuary for birds and wildlife.
The Canadian Warplane Heritage Museum lets you explore real historic aircraft up close and even offers flights on a Lancaster bomber, one of only two still flying in the world!
Dundurn Castle is a beautiful 19th-century mansion that lets visitors step back into Victorian times and discover how a wealthy Canadian family lived in the 1850s.
The Hamilton Farmers' Market has been running since 1837 and is one of the oldest farmers' markets in Canada, buzzing with fresh local produce, baked goods, and friendly vendors.
